DES MOINES, IOWA (August 10, 2023) — Governor Kim Reynolds has announced a new funding opportunity targeted to support CDL programs at Iowa Community Colleges. The Iowa CDL Infrastructure Grant will provide $5 million in grants to support the infrastructure of programs that train individuals working to receive their commercial driver's license (CDL).

DES MOINES, IOWA (August 10, 2023) — Governor Kim Reynolds has announced her appointment of Samuel Langholz as a judge on the Iowa Court of Appeals.  Langholz, of Ankeny, Iowa, serves in the Attorney General’s Office, where he is currently the Chief Deputy Attorney General under Attorney General Brenna Bird and was previously the Assistant Solicitor General under Attorney General Tom Miller.
